Market Notes
Supply included: 50% Feeder Cattle (13% Steers, 53% Heifers, 35% Bulls); 31% Slaughter Cattle (91% Cows, 9% Bulls); 19% Replacement Cattle (78% Bred Cows, 22% Cow-Calf Pairs). Feeder cattle supply over 600 lbs was 11%. AUCTION This Week Last Reported 4/12/2023 Last Year Total Receipts: 263 254 292 Feeder Cattle: 132(50.2%) 209(82.3%) 235(80.5%) Slaughter Cattle: 81(30.8%) 24(9.4%) 45(15.4%) Replacement Cattle: 50(19.0%) 21(8.3%) 12(4.1%)
